Patricia June Mathews' Obituary
Patricia June "Patsy" Mathews, 68, of Prince George County passed away Sunday, Jan. 1, 2012, at her home.
Patsy was known best for her loving spirit and friendly nature to everyone she knew. She was a devoted and loving wife, mother and grandmother. She retired from Giant Food as a clerk after 32 years, and served as the women's ministry leader at her church.
Patsy leaves behind her husband of 53 years, Larry; a son, Coy Thomas Mathews and his wife, Christine F., of Spotsylvania County; a daughter, Tina Lynn Taylor and her husband, Ronald W., of Fauquier County; and seven grandchildren, Jesse, Brandon, Trevor, Seth, Sarah, Rachel and Luke. She also leaves behind two brothers, Raymond Stanley and his wife, Pat, of Vinton and Johnny Stanley and his wife, Mary, of Thornburg; and two sisters, Peggy Carter of Woodbridge and Kay Derr and her husband, Ron, of South Carolina.
Patsy was preceded in death by her first grandchild, Joshua I. Taylor.
Patsy's family will receive friends from 7 to 9 p.m. Tuesday, Jan. 3, at Found and Sons Funeral-Cremation Services, 10719 Courthouse Road, Fredericksburg.
A service will be held in her honor at 11 a.m. Wednesday, Jan. 4, at the funeral home, with the Rev. David Nichols officiating. Interment will follow at 1:30 p.m. in Mount Comfort Cemetery, 6600 North Kings Highway, Alexandria.
